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ger collected a record-breaking $12 million in campaign contributions in the first six months of this year, a large chunk of which came from a select list of powerful longtime California political donors, according to campaign finance reports filed Monday with the secretary of state's office.
Schwarzenegger amassed contributions in five separate campaign accounts during the first half of the year, including six-figure sums to his California Recovery Team that financed campaigns for his successful bond measure in March and signature-gathering efforts to push for changes in the California workers' compensation system.
He also has raised hundreds of thousands in smaller donations in his 2006 re-election account, which he has used to stage campaign-style events to press for his budget plan and to foot the bill for the hotel suite that he calls home in Sacramento.
During last year's recall campaign against Gray Davis, Schwarzenegger said he didn't need to raise campaign money from outside interests because of his personal wealth. But the Republican governor raised twice the amount between January and June that Davis did during his record-setting first six months in office.
"The governor is raising these funds to accomplish the ambitious reform agenda that the voters elected him on," said Marty Wilson, Schwarzenegger's chief fund-raiser.
